Sex and contraception after childbirth


The World Health Organisation recognises the importance of pleasurable and safe sexual experiences, and the ability to control the number, timing and spacing of one’s children.1 In the UK, there has been much focus on developing sexual health policies and services for younger age groups which has led to a welcome fall in rates of unintended pregnancy.
